Details: An exciting opportunity has opened to contribute to the Office of International Engagement through the position of Director, Engagement Programs. This position will contribute to collaboratively developing and implementing high quality, evidence-based programs to deliver on the ACT Government's objective of promoting Canberra as a place to invest, do business, visit and study through Canberra's International Engagement Strategy.
